Abstract

The purpose of the article is to develop tools for diagnosing the economic dynamics of regional socio-economic systems in the conditions of digitalization of economic relations on the basis of the modernized Cobb–Douglas production function. Much attention is given to methodological approaches to the formalized assessment of the impact of the digital transformation of the region on the parameters and prospects of its economic growth. The author draws attention to models determining the degree of influence of the main production factors (labor, capital, digital transformation) on the dynamics of gross regional product growth of the studied group of regions. Key patterns of the influence of digitalization of regional socio-economic systems of Volga Federal District on regional economic dynamics are revealed. It is stressed that the obtained results form the basis for the development of the most effective and adaptive directions of intensification of economic growth in the regions in accordance with the concept of diffusion of digital technologies into the economic environment. As a result, the author draws conclusions that the developed approach is advisable to use when conducting research in the field of assessing current and prospective parameters of the development of regional socio-economic systems in the new conditions of globalization and digitalization.
